Abstract
A computer readable medium includes executable instructions for managing server configuration data by configuring a first server using local server configuration data, where the local server configuration data is stored on the first server and as shared server configuration data by a first directory service instance operating on the first server, synchronizing the first directory service instance with a second directory service instance operating on a second server, where the shared server configuration data is updated, and updating the local server configuration data using the updated shared server configuration data.
